Skip to main content

A workflow orchestration platform for multi-agent collaboration

Project description

Flowent

npm version npm monthly downloads PyPI version PyPI monthly downloads
License CI Release Docker

Flowent

A workflow orchestration platform for multi-agent collaboration.

Install

Flowent requires Bubblewrap for local tool isolation and ripgrep for file search. Install the system packages first:

sudo apt-get install bubblewrap ripgrep

Install the CLI globally:

npm install -g flowent

Or install it with pip:

pip install flowent

Start the server:

flowent

Check system requirements:

flowent doctor

Docker Compose

Run the server with Docker Compose:

docker compose up

Tech Stack

  • Vite: frontend development server and build tool.
  • React: UI rendering model.
  • FastAPI: local application server and settings API.
  • uv: Python dependency and environment management.
  • Tailwind CSS: utility-first styling.
  • Shadcn UI: standard component patterns.
  • Lucide Icons: shared icon set.
  • Framer Motion: advanced interaction and transition animation.

Development

Install dependencies and start the local development server:

sudo apt-get install bubblewrap ripgrep
pnpm install
uv sync --project backend
pnpm dev

You can also run the development container:

docker compose -f docker-compose.dev.yml up

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

flowent-0.3.5.tar.gz (1.2 MB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

flowent-0.3.5-py3-none-any.whl (1.2 MB view details)

Uploaded Python 3

File details

Details for the file flowent-0.3.5.tar.gz.

File metadata

  • Download URL: flowent-0.3.5.tar.gz
  • Upload date:
  • Size: 1.2 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for flowent-0.3.5.tar.gz
Algorithm Hash digest
SHA256 6bca7f360232e1331924532a69a3f8049d1e01edcd2cc047a10c49545e3f7c69
MD5 d0fa9ca52167e5085f93a67164f865e0
BLAKE2b-256 c44bce25a3122c8be28400a4d9c0373a49351caa62094b3e8d71d1dbbf3ff976

See more details on using hashes here.

Provenance

The following attestation bundles were made for flowent-0.3.5.tar.gz:

Publisher: pypi-publish.yml on ImFeH2/flowent

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file flowent-0.3.5-py3-none-any.whl.

File metadata

  • Download URL: flowent-0.3.5-py3-none-any.whl
  • Upload date:
  • Size: 1.2 MB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.12

File hashes

Hashes for flowent-0.3.5-py3-none-any.whl
Algorithm Hash digest
SHA256 4f3fb385d43c92f9934bea86430eaae9ccd2994889f26fced57d1302d6dc82d1
MD5 7cbfa58a58e364d99d518ab7f0e9800d
BLAKE2b-256 538a7ecdfd42b0f403550e1094806d2d58a9f8a7f5b31c9e6b5c93631e54a4cc

See more details on using hashes here.

Provenance

The following attestation bundles were made for flowent-0.3.5-py3-none-any.whl:

Publisher: pypi-publish.yml on ImFeH2/flowent

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page